:&#039;&#039;Mach Five Racing Prime is an [[Autobot]] from the [[Transformers GT: Mission GT-R (franchise)|Transformers GT]] portion of the [[Generation 1 continuity family]].&#039;&#039;&lt;br /&gt;
[[File:YDSB MachPrime.jpg|thumb|right|300px|&amp;quot;To win he&#039;ll stop at nothing!&amp;quot;]]&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&#039;&#039;&#039;Mach Five Racing Prime&#039;&#039;&#039; (マッハ号レーシングプライム &#039;&#039;Mahha-gō Rēshingu Puraimu&#039;&#039;) does not actually transform into the [[wikipedia:Mach Five|Mach Five]], but into [http://www.mach5.jp/teammach/index.php Team Mach]&#039;s Nissan GT-R racing car.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==Fiction==&lt;br /&gt;
===&#039;&#039;Transformers Legends&#039;&#039; comic===&lt;br /&gt;
Mach Five Racing Prime was among the mascots that appeared at the [[Tokyo Toy Show]], where somebody mistook him for [[Safety Prime]]. {{storylink|Tokyo Toy Show 2014 Report}}&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===Yokohama Decepticon Secret Base===&lt;br /&gt;
Mach Five Racing Prime helped [[Yokohama Prime]] and [[Kawasaki Prime]] contain the evil [[Yokohama Convoy|Nemesis Prime]], leaping onto the villain and attempting to tear off his [[Dark Energon]] stickers. He failed and was blasted away for his efforts. {{storylink|Yokohama Decepticon Secret Base}}&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==Notes==&lt;br /&gt;
[[File:Mach Prime at pit walk.jpg|thumb|right]]&lt;br /&gt;
*Mach Five Racing Prime was created as part of the &#039;&#039;Transformers GT&#039;&#039; [http://www.takaratomy.co.jp/products/tf30th/teammach/ collaboration] between [[TakaraTomy]] and Team Mach, a [[wikipedia:Super GT|Super GT]] racing team with a &#039;&#039;[[wikipedia:Speed Racer|Speed Racer]]&#039;&#039; theme. An actor cosplaying as him appeared at several events in 2014, including Super GT pit walks and the Tokyo Toy Show.&lt;br /&gt;
*His design is based on the [[Bluestreak (G1)#Chronicle|Legends Class Bluestreak]] toy (lacking the lightbar of the [[Prowl (G1)/toys#2010legend|Prowl]] version) in the colors of Team Mach&#039;s Nissan GT-R Nismo GT3. The coloration of his head makes him look a lot like [[Smokescreen (G1)|Smokescreen]].&lt;br /&gt;
*The character apparently went unnamed during his event appearances, but the &#039;&#039;Transformers Legends&#039;&#039; comic nicknamed him &amp;quot;Mach Five Racing Prime&amp;quot; after the &#039;&#039;Speed Racer&#039;&#039; vehicle that inspired the Nissan GT-R&#039;s color scheme.&lt;br /&gt;

:&#039;&#039;Brawl is a [[Decepticon]] from the [[Movie (franchise)|live-action movie]] [[continuity family]]. He is sometimes referred to as &#039;&#039;&#039;Devastator&#039;&#039;&#039;.&#039;&#039;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
[[Image:Brawl-cyber-slammer-boxart.jpg|right|thumb|300px|Maybe he was &#039;&#039;talking&#039;&#039; to Devastator earlier and got confused.]]&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
To say &#039;&#039;&#039;Brawl&#039;&#039;&#039; is a warrior is like calling [[Cybertron (planet)|Cybertron]] a hunk of metal.  Brawl does not just enjoy fighting, he is consumed by it.  Tearing Autobots apart is embedded into his very core, and every fiber-optic cable of his being is obsessed with wild, unyielding combat.  The only thing he enjoys, or even cares about, is the fury of battle. And he &#039;&#039;loves&#039;&#039; a good explosion.  Particularly if it&#039;s one he created, and if it was an [[Autobot]] that is exploding.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
{{quote|These things just don&#039;t die.|[[William Lennox]] on Brawl&#039;s durability|[[Transformers (2007)|Transformers]]}}&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
:&#039;&#039;Alternate name:&#039;&#039; &#039;&#039;&#039;Devastator&#039;&#039;&#039;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
== Fiction ==&lt;br /&gt;
===&#039;&#039;Ghosts of Yesterday&#039;&#039; novel===&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Brawl was oddly absent from events surrounding the &#039;&#039;[[Ghost 1]]&#039;&#039; discovery. Whether he was aboard the &#039;&#039;[[Nemesis (Movie)|Nemesis]]&#039;&#039; and otherwise indisposed or joined up with [[Starscream (Movie)|Starscream]] at a later date is unknown.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===Transformers The Game (console)===&lt;br /&gt;
:&#039;&#039;Voice actor&#039;&#039;: [[David Sobolov]]&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
[[Image:Brawlmovie tank activision.jpg|thumb|250px|left|I have many, many guns; I can call myself whatever I want!]]&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
====Autobot campaign====&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Brawl arrived in [[Mission City]] shortly after [[Jazz (Movie)|Jazz]] took down [[Starscream (Movie)|Starscream]], [[Blackout (Movie)|Blackout]] and a pair of [[Dreadwing (Movie)|Dreadwings]] single-handedly.  The Autobot&#039;s victory was short-lived... and so was the Autobot, as Brawl punctured Jazz&#039;s chest with his claw, extinguishing his [[spark]].  [[Ironhide (Movie)|Ironhide]] arrived just in time to witness the killing, and fought through a horde of Decepticon units to destroy Brawl.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
====Decepticon campaign====&lt;br /&gt;
Brawl, [[Bonecrusher (Movie)|Bonecrusher]] and Starscream were hiding out in a human military installation in the desert when they received word that [[Frenzy (Movie)|Frenzy]] and [[Barricade (Movie)|Barricade]] had discovered the location of the [[AllSpark]].  When the three Decepticons mobilized, the two ground-based machines were assaulted by tanks designed to fire holding beams of electrical energy, forcing Starscream to back-and-forth babysit the two Decepticons as they tried to escape.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Brawl later stood by [[Megatron (Movie)|Megatron&#039;s ]] side in Washington D.C. after they had retrieved the AllSpark from the destroyed Autobots and had decimated pretty much everything in their path.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
:&#039;&#039;(&#039;&#039;&#039;Note&#039;&#039;&#039;: Brawl was not a playable character in the console versions of the game.)&#039;&#039;&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===&#039;&#039;Transformers&#039;&#039; (2007) film===&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
{{spoiler}}&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Brawl (here called &amp;quot;Devastator&amp;quot;) was lying in wait at a military depot when Starscream contacted the Decepticon infiltration team, informing them that the All Spark had been found and they were to move out. Devastator acknowledged that he was in transit and rolled out of the depot. He met up with [[Barricade (Movie)|Barricade]] and [[Bonecrusher (Movie)|Bonecrusher]] and hit the highway, though Devastator separated from the group before Barricade and Bonecrusher got on the freeway and met up with Autobot/human convoy.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Arriving at [[Mission City]] in the aftermath of Starscream&#039;s opening attack on the Autobots and their [[William Lennox|human]] [[Robert Epps|allies]], Devastator fired shells from his main gun, narrowly missing several targets before running over vehicles abandoned by human bystanders. As the American soldiers fanned out in search of cover, the Autobots charged Devastator. He focused his attacks on [[Ironhide (Movie)|Ironhide]], who was forced to somersault over his shells. This distraction allowed the Autobot Jazz to jump on top of Devastator and point his cannon away from the humans. Devastator managed to transform and throw the smaller Autobot off him, but not before Jazz destroyed his left side rocket launcher pod.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Damaged, but not down, Devastator fired two rockets from his remaining launcher, missing the heavily armed Autobot as he somersaulted over the missiles. Ironhide and Jazz managed to fire several shots at Devastator, disorienting him. [[Ratchet (Movie)|Ratchet]] followed up by using his buzzsaw to slice off Devastator&#039;s left arm. The humans then fired a volley of sabot rounds, which knocked Devastator to the ground. The only thing that saved him was the Autobots and humans&#039; retreat at the arrival of [[Megatron (Movie)|Megatron]]. Eventually, Ironhide and Ratchet disengaged from the battle as they left to protect [[Sam Witwicky|ladiesman217]], who was escaping with the All Spark, while Jazz took on Megatron. Now with fewer targets to deal with, Devastator sprayed heavy machine gun fire at the remaining humans, whose leader remarked that the battle was not going well.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Devastator continued to pin down the soldiers until the damaged Autobot [[Bumblebee (Movie)|Bumblebee]] suddenly attacked while on the back of of a tow truck driven by Ladiesman217&#039;s [[Mikaela Banes|female companion]]. With Bumblebee&#039;s plasma cannon being the deciding factor, the human soldiers rallied and fired more sabots, piercing Devastator&#039;s armor until a final shot from Bumblebee struck Devastator&#039;s spark and killed him.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Devastator&#039;s body was dumped into the deepest part of the ocean along with his fellow Decepticons, in the hopes the intense pressure and cold will destroy whatever remained. {{Storylink|Transformers (2007)}}&lt;br /&gt;

: Deluxe-class Brawl transforms into a heavily modified fictional tank based upon an [[wikipedia:M1_Abrams|M1A1 Abrams]], fitted with angular reflective armor, a mine plow and external spare fuel canisters. Mounted upon the turret is a smaller sub-turret housing two anti-aircraft cannons and rocket launchers. The spring-loaded main cannon fires a translucent red projectile.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
: In robot mode, Brawl faithfully replicates his movie design, with the only major divergence being that his main gun does not split into smaller guns (although the guns ARE on the back half of the gun, which can be spun around). He is reasonably articulated, with ball and swivel joints in his arms and legs. Thanks to [[Automorph]]ing, pushing down on the front of his tank during transformation raises the front of the treads and his head up into position for his robot mode, and vice versa for the tank mode. He is armed with his spring-loaded main gun on his right arm and a flip-out blade on his left.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
: There is a design flaw in the way Brawl&#039;s arms attach to his torso - the rhombic peg and socket system used does not provide a tight enough fit, and thus the arms have a tendency to detach at the shoulder when moved. There have also been some reports of the gears for the treads crack easily and no longer function properly. At least you can Reenact that part in the movie Where Rachet Saws off Brawl&#039;s arm.&lt;br /&gt;

:The larger, more heavily armed version of Brawl, this figure is somewhat more accurate to the character&#039;s CGI model, but with a somewhat inaccurate transformation.  It features Brawl&#039;s smaller, four-gun turret on his right arm, plus the previously omitted Gattling gun on behing the claw on his left arm.  The only major diversion in his design is the main turret now resting near his right hip, a la &#039;&#039;Armada&#039;&#039; Megatron.  It features more articulation joints and weapons than the Deluxe-class figure, as is to be expected.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
:While having no firing missiles, it does feature a number of Automorph gimmicks.  First, pressing the button on the front of the tank causes his head and chest pieces to move into position.  A scoop/claw has been added to the front of the tank, probably to make the lever to push his head back down stand out less. Second, pressing the headlights on either side of the front end causes the paneling to swing back into place.  Finally, by pulling the cannon on the left arm back, the claw swings forward.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
:Other features include lights and sounds, acticated by pushing back on the main cannon or turning the upper turret, and a pair of blades that swing down from the legs.  Because of the positioning of these blades, the edges face down, toward his feet.  They&#039;re also undocumented anywhere on the box or instructions, probably out of embarassment.&lt;br /&gt;

==Trivia==&lt;br /&gt;
* During the movie, Brawl is identified in subtitles as &#039;Devastator&#039;, an early working name for the character. When queried, director [[Michael Bay]] said he had always preferred Devastator and that it is not a mistake. Writer [[Roberto Orci]] felt that it was a mistake that would hopefully be fixed before the full official release of the film, this did not happen.  At [[Botcon]] 2007 Hasbro representatives said they consider &amp;quot;Devastator&amp;quot; a &amp;quot;continuity glitch&amp;quot; and as far as they are concerned the character&#039;s name is Brawl.  Despite rumors to the contrary, he is &#039;&#039;not credited&#039;&#039; in the film under either name.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
* According to Picture Vehicle Coordinator [[Steve Mann]], the filming prop of Brawl was a redress of a tank prop made  for another movie [http://enewsi.com/news.php?catid=190&amp;amp;itemid=11213]. Specifically, it was the &#039;stealth tank&#039; seen in the film &#039;&#039;XXX: State of the Union&#039;&#039;.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
*The name &#039;Brawl&#039; was previously a working name for the character now called [[Barricade (Movie)|Barricade.]]&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
* A wallpaper on Hasbro&#039;s Transformers web site labels Brawl as &amp;quot;Demolisher&amp;quot;, one of several working names for this character.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
*Brawl, under the name Devastator appears in the second issue of the Titan&#039;s published Transformers magazine/comic, where he takes over from Megatron in fighting Ratchet and Ironhide.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
*Jazz&#039; move of racing-transforming-boarding Brawl is not completely unlike the scene in [[The Transformers: The Movie]] where [[Kup]] does the same thing with [[Blitzwing (G1)|Blitzwing]].&lt;br /&gt;
